Lorekeep enforces role-based access at the page level. Roles: `viewer`, `editor`, `curator`, `admin`. Plugins inherit the invoking user's role — no escalation. Query permissions via the `acl_check()` helper, never by reading the `roles` table directly. Permission grants cascade down page trees unless a node sets `inherit=false`. Sandbox plugins run against the staging permissions database, refreshed nightly from production with user data scrubbed. Connect your plugin's test harness to staging with the string below.

primary connection of yagep-kahip = redis://giliel_svc:zYiKsLL2PLpfPL@db-348f.xolmarsys.corp:5432/fenwyn

Step 6: Export memory check. Run the Tallyform spreadsheet export against the 200k-row fixture and confirm peak RSS stays under 1.5 GB. If it climbs, the streaming writer is buffering; check the chunk flag. Once the check passes, sign the release artifact using the deploy key that follows.

deploy key for kajof-fajop: bky6_gDHw9Q

## Per-Tenant Rate Quotas: Who Owns This?

Quota complaints land with us a lot, but support can't change limits directly. The Throttlr team at Marlbeck owns per-tenant quotas end to end — bumps, resets, and the occasional mystery 429 storm. Grab the tenant ID and the time window before you reach out; they'll ask anyway. Then drop them a line here.

escalation mailbox, bafog-fafog: ulador@paliqlabs.internal

TURN-208: Gatevale turnstile counters at the Merrow Field pilot double-count when a rotation reverses mid-cycle. Attendance totals drift roughly 2% high per event. The debounce window fix is implemented, reviewed by Ilsa, and soak-tested across two simulated match days without drift. Ready for your cut; the candidate build is identified below.

trace token, tagag-tafog: htk6_5ed18c